Transaction 59596c891be156370029a6d23e9c81e233f40802b9d27c0c3441e3f1390a77bb
1 Input
1 Output
-
59596c891be156370029a6d23e9c81e233f40802b9d27c0c3441e3f1390a77bb:0
- value
- 22992
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 efa7f28f1d10ca4dde1b2b63d5cb9413ffa524a5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NrBh3ZJGf9K2W2VzREViutA5TCSSBpkPy